- Cardinal Richelieu
- chief minister to Louis XIII who ran the government of France from 1624-1642. He created the system o government by which France was governed until the French Revolution.
- Louis XIV

- Metternich
- Chief Minister of austria. Chief architect of the policies drawn up by the congress of vienna. Believed strongly in absolute monarchy. liberalism is horrible. aimed to prevent war and preserve absolutism.

- Smith
- Wrote The Wealth of Nations. Two laws: of supply and demand and of law of cmpetion. free enterprise.
- Malthus
- Wrote An Essay On The Principle of Population. population increases present the greatest obstacle to human progress. famines, epidemics, wars. misery and poverty is inevitable.
- Bentham
- Stongly believed that every act ofa society should be judged in terms of its utility, or usefullness. known as utilitarianism. people needed education. happiness is yummy.
- Mill
- philosopher. believes in laissez-faire but criticized economic inustices and inequalities of british society. govt should protect working children and improve housign nd factory conditions. govt shoudl work for well beign of all citizens. all people of certain ange plus women should be able to vote. individual liberty is basic human right. govt should gurantee liberty.

- Cavour
- governed sardinia. dislikek absolutism and admitted the British system of parliamentary govt. reorganized and strenghtened sardinian army. estsblished banks, railroads. increased trade. reduce political influence of church.
